使用DBMS_SCHEDULER和日志输出执行shell脚本

时间:2017-01-30 12:32:36

标签: bash oracle11g dbms-scheduler

我有几个DBMS_SCHEDULER作业,它们执行这样的shell脚本:

dbms_scheduler.create_job (
           job_name => 'my_job',
           job_type => 'EXECUTABLE',
           job_action => '/path/to/my_shell.sh',
           enabled => true,
           auto_drop => true,
);

在shell脚本中,从crontab调用这些shell脚本时会记录一些echo's。我尝试将stdout重定向到此job_action => '/path/to/my_shell.sh >> /path/to/my_log.log'内的Oracle作业中,但这并不起作用。那么,有没有办法在不编辑shell脚本的情况下实现这一目标呢?

提前致谢!

0 个答案:

没有答案